App State во FlutterFlow: как настроить глобальные переменные и корзину товаров
Автор: Константин Попов
Загружено: 2025-09-14
Просмотров: 168
Если вам нужно разработать приложение, оставьте заявку на платформе RIWO — я или моя команда подключимся к вашему проекту 👉🏻 https://riwo.ru/?t=employer&utm_sourc...
Больше интересного о нейросетях и no-code в моём ТГ-канале👉🏻 https://t.me/+uG7M91m62MhiMzEy
В этом видео я подробно расскажу, как использовать App State во FlutterFlow — один из ключевых инструментов для хранения и передачи данных между страницами вашего no-code приложения. App State — это глобальные переменные, доступные во всём проекте, и именно они позволяют делать взаимодействие пользователя с приложением более динамичным и персонализированным 🚀
00:00 Приветствие и тема видео — App State во FlutterFlow
00:21 Уровни переменных во FlutterFlow: Component State, Page State, App State
00:40 Как создать App State переменную (username, string, integer, object)
01:21 Persistent переменные — сохранение данных после перезагрузки
01:48 Пример: регистрация пользователя и сохранение имени в App State
02:12 Rebuild All, Rebuild Current Page, No Rebuild — что выбрать?
02:57 Вывод имени пользователя на главной странице (App State Username)
03:20 Создание корзины товаров во FlutterFlow с помощью App State
03:42 Подключение API и маппинг данных для списка товаров
04:29 Создание переменной Cart типа List of JSON в App State
04:59 Настройка кнопки «Добавить в корзину» и сохранение товаров
05:21 Экран корзины: вывод товаров из App State Cart
05:45 Тестирование корзины и работа глобальных переменных
Я покажу, как создавать переменные App State, когда их лучше использовать, чем они отличаются от Page State и Component State. Вы увидите на практике, как они применяются для хранения имени пользователя после регистрации, а также — как реализовать корзину товаров с помощью App State во FlutterFlow, используя API-запрос и работу с JSON-объектами.
🔧 Что вы узнаете из этого видео:
Как устроены глобальные переменные App State
Когда использовать App State, а когда Page State или Component State
Какие типы данных можно сохранять (String, Boolean, JSON, List и др.)
Как сохранять значение App State даже после перезапуска приложения
Как правильно обновлять переменные и перерисовывать интерфейс
Как связать переменные App State с действиями пользователя
Как создать корзину товаров на FlutterFlow и связать её с App State
Как подключить API, обработать JSON-ответ и отобразить данные в ListView
Как грамотно работать с JSONPath в интерфейсе
🔥 Видео особенно полезно:
No-code разработчикам, которые создают мобильные или веб-приложения во FlutterFlow
Предпринимателям и фрилансерам, которые хотят быстро протестировать MVP
Тем, кто хочет автоматизировать процессы и не тратить время на программирование
Всем, кто сталкивался с болью: «как передать данные между страницами» или «как сохранить состояние корзины» в приложении
🎯 App State во FlutterFlow часто вызывает вопросы у начинающих no-code разработчиков: как правильно настроить глобальные переменные, где хранить пользовательские данные, как сделать корзину, которая не обнуляется при перезапуске приложения. Все эти боли я детально разбираю в видео.
Я демонстрирую всё на практике: от настройки проекта и создания переменных App State до интеграции с API и отображения списка товаров. Это не просто теория — это рабочий кейс, который вы сможете повторить и адаптировать под свои задачи 💡
Многие no-code разработчики боятся сложных логик или путаются в состоянии приложения. App State — это решение, которое делает архитектуру вашего проекта понятной и управляемой. Я расскажу, как использовать Rebuild Current Page, Rebuild All Pages и No Rebuild — и когда какой вариант выбирать.
Также вы узнаете, как работать с Persisted-переменными, чтобы сохранять значения даже после закрытия приложения. Это критично для UX и позволит вам создавать приложения, которыми приятно пользоваться 🧠
В видео я использую реальные примеры:
Передача имени пользователя между регистрацией и главной страницей
Хранение списка товаров из API в переменной App State
Реализация кнопки «Добавить в корзину»
Настройка отображения содержимого корзины на отдельном экране
FlutterFlow позволяет создать мощные продукты без кода, но без понимания App State во FlutterFlow вы не сможете сделать по-настоящему интерактивные приложения. Это обязательная тема для каждого no-code разработчика!
📲 Подписывайтесь, ставьте лайк, активируйте колокольчик — и напишите в комментариях, какой пример оказался для вас самым полезным!
Подпишитесь на мои социальные сети, чтобы получать полезную информацию о no-code и нейросетях:
👉🏻 YouTube канал: / @konstantinpopov.
👉🏻 Телеграм канал: https://t.me/+uG7M91m62MhiMzEy
👉🏻 VK: https://vk.com/popov_konst
👉🏻 Дзен: https://dzen.ru/popov_konst
#flutterflow #nocode #appstate #глобальныепеременные #разработкаприложений

Доступные форматы для скачивания:
Скачать видео mp4
-
Информация по загрузке: